The global Guanidine Sulfamate market size was valued at approximately USD 430 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 670 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 4.5% during the forecast period. The market plays a crucial role in various industries, such as textile processing, flame retardants, and pharmaceuticals. Guanidine Sulfamate is known for its properties as a cleaning agent and flame-retardant, predominantly employed in manufacturing sectors, contributing to its wide application scope.
